Security Bulletin

Summary

IBM Dojo Toolkit is vulnerable to cross-site scripting and affects IBM Image 
Construction and Composition Tool.

Vulnerability Details

CVEID: CVE-2014-8917

DESCRIPTION: IBM Dojo Toolkit is vulnerable to cross-site scripting, caused by
improper validation of user-supplied input.

CVSS Base Score: 4.3

CVSS Temporal Score: See http://xforce.iss.net/xforce/xfdb/99303 for the 
current score

CVSS Environmental Score*: Undefined

CVSS Vector: (AV:N/AC:M/Au:N/C:N/I:P/A:N)

Affected Products and Versions

IBM Image Construction and Composition Tool v2.2.1.3

IBM Image Construction and Composition Tool v2.3.1.0

IBM Image Construction and Composition Tool v2.3.2.0

Remediation/Fixes

The solution is to apply the following IBM Image Construction and Composition
Tool version fixes.

Upgrade the IBM Image Construction and Composition Tool to the following fix 
levels or higher:
